Pressure washing services involve using high-pressure water streams to clean exterior surfaces of properties. This method effectively removes dirt, grime, mold, algae, and other buildups that accumulate over time. The process typically involves specialized equipment operated by experienced contractors who adjust the pressure and cleaning solutions to suit different surfaces. Homeowners often seek pressure washing to restore the appearance of their property, prepare surfaces for painting, or maintain cleanliness around their homes.

This service helps address several common problems faced by homeowners. Over time, exterior surfaces such as siding, decks, driveways, and fences can become stained or covered with algae and moss, making them look worn and unkempt. Pressure washing can eliminate these issues, preventing potential damage caused by mold or grime buildup. It also helps improve curb appeal, making a property look fresh and well-maintained, which can be especially important before selling or hosting events.

The overview below groups typical Pressure Washing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Pressure Washing Jobs - typical costs range from $150-$400 for routine cleaning of driveways, decks, or small exteriors. Many projects fall into this middle range, with fewer jobs reaching the lower or higher ends. Local service providers can often handle these smaller, straightforward tasks efficiently.

Medium-Sized Projects - costs usually range from $400-$1,200 for larger areas like multiple-story homes or extensive patios. These projects are common and represent the most typical price band for residential pressure washing. Larger, more complex jobs may push beyond this range.

Large or Complex Jobs - prices can range from $1,200-$3,000 for significant commercial properties or heavily soiled surfaces. While less frequent, some projects, such as building facades or industrial cleanup, fall into this tier. Local contractors may provide customized quotes for these larger jobs.

Full Property or Heavy-Duty Cleaning - costs often exceed $3,000, especially for comprehensive exterior overhauls or commercial-scale projects. These high-end projects are less common and typically involve extensive preparation and equipment. Local pros can assess and provide tailored estimates for such large-scale work.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What surfaces can be cleaned with pressure washing? Pressure washing is effective on various surfaces including siding, decks, driveways, walkways, and fences. It helps remove dirt, grime, mold, and algae from these areas.

Is pressure washing safe for my property? When performed by experienced service providers, pressure washing is generally safe for most property exteriors. Professionals adjust pressure levels to prevent damage to delicate surfaces.

How often should I have my property pressure washed? The frequency depends on the property's location and exposure to elements. Typically, annual or bi-annual cleanings help maintain appearance and prevent buildup.

What are the benefits of hiring local contractors for pressure washing? Local contractors often have experience with regional conditions and can provide tailored services to meet specific needs, ensuring quality results.

Can pressure washing remove stubborn stains? Yes, professional pressure washing can effectively remove stubborn stains such as oil, rust, and mildew from various surfaces with appropriate techniques and equipment.
